Released January 1st, 2000, 'Intrepid' stars Alex Hyde-White The R mov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 30 min, and received a score of 41 (out of 100) on TMDb, which put together reviews from 9 well-known s.

Curious to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Hotshot Navy special ops guys get assigned to take a cruise to keep an eye on a VIP's daughter. Once the voyage is under way, somehow a nuke A) gets lost in the vicinity, and goes off. The resulting tidal wave capsizes the cruise ship, and its up to our heros to save the day" .
